Output 3957eaa6931c6bc717c8183c8088c084ca00ae8f6ca32df8e0ed813b2cc56483:0

value
1323618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ce4934cd8adc1e92852b9e4c35308d723603a3d OP_EQUAL
address
3D5PY2YE7qZMsYn4eZqYyvCjvEAWiRRrkm
transaction
3957eaa6931c6bc717c8183c8088c084ca00ae8f6ca32df8e0ed813b2cc56483
spent
true